SSH-ключи — это специальный код, который используется для идентификации клиента при подключении к серверу по SSH-протоколу. Этот способ используется вместо аутентификации по паролю.
В тех операционных системах, где имеется поддержка протокола SSH для удалённого администрирования, допустимо управление ключами SSH через интерфейс панели управления.
Создание ключа
SSH-ключи автоматически копируются при установке операционной системы. Для создания новой пары ключей необходимо:
1. Зайти в «Главное меню» → «SSH ключи» и нажать кнопку «Создать»
2. Ввести желаемое наименование ключа. Так он будет отображаться в таблице веб-панели.
3. Скопировать содержимое ключа в текстовое поле «Публичный SSH ключ»
Настройка авторизации по ключу состоит из создания ключа на локальном компьютере и копировании его на сервер; процедура отличается в зависимости от используемой вами операционной системы.
SSH-ключ разделён на две части: закрытый и открытый ключ. Одна часть называется «Наименование ключа» (закрытый) и должна всегда храниться только в личном кабинете. Вторая часть ключа называется «Публичный SSH-ключ» (открытый ключ) эта часть отправляется на сервер и размещается в файле authorized_keys.
При подключении к серверу SSH-ключ сравнивает публичную часть, которую вы ему дали с приватной частью, которая хранится на сервере. Если части ключа совпадают, то вы получаете доступ к удалённому серверу.
Пример заполнения:
